Charles Brockden Brown is considered a foundational figure in early American national literature.
Born in Philadelphia, his work deeply reflects the historical and political context of his time.
His talent was multifaceted, excelling not only as a novelist but also as a historian, editor, and lawyer.
The novel Wieland remains his most iconic work, widely recognized by readers.
Throughout his prolific career, he published a total of 118 works exploring diverse social themes.
